Subject: StormRelay cut-over complete

All,

Weather-alert fan-out moved to StormRelay last night. Legacy broadcaster at Kelsden is off. Fan-out latency dropped from 9s to under 2s. Dedup window is now 60 seconds; regional sharding is live for the Norvale and Ashpoint zones. New team members: read the alerting doc first. The live configuration values follow below.

settings of yaguf-bahip:
druwyn:
  log_level: debug
  metrics_host: metrics.druwyn.qorvelsys.internal
  pool_size: 32

Hi release folks,

Quick heads-up on SproutMinder 3.2: the watering scheduler now respects per-zone quiet hours, so no more 3 a.m. sprinkler complaints. We also fixed the bug where skipping a rain day shifted the whole week's schedule. Support team — if customers report missed waterings after upgrading, have them re-sync the hub once; that clears the stale calendar. Rollout starts Thursday. When escalating, please include the build token shown below.

pipeline stamp: htk9_ce63042d9

**Ticket: Undo/redo acting weird in Sketchloom — config drift suspected**

Hey, welcome aboard! Quick one for you: undo and redo in the Sketchloom diagram editor behave differently on staging vs prod. Staging keeps about 50 history steps, prod seems to cap at 10 and sometimes drops redo entirely. We think someone hand-edited staging ages ago and it never got synced. To compare, here's what prod is currently running with.

service settings:
druael:
  pin: 7528
  metrics_host: metrics.druael.lumiclabs.internal
  tenant: wendor
  seal: seal_c765840a

Partner file drops from Orvane Logistics land on the Quayhook SFTP bridge every night between 01:00 and 02:30 local. If the ingest job reports no new files by 03:00, first confirm the bridge container is healthy, then verify the partner's upload directory is not full. Do not delete partial files; the partner re-uploads automatically. Before any manual retry, confirm the bridge is running with exactly these settings.

deployment values, bagap-kagap:
OLIIX_HOST=oliix.qorvellabs.internal
OLIIX_PORT=8000